"4. Out-reach and In-reach"
LACRALO might have found a way to improve participation, and that's to
have its monthly call extended to 90 minutes instead of 60 minutes, but
each monthly call contains a 30-45 minute Capacity Building Webinar,
where they invite an expert from ICANN, sometimes a staff member,
sometimes someone from another part of ICANN's community, sometimes an
in-house expert, to speak about a subject and answer questions. It is
hoped that as a result, more people from ALSes will start understanding
the issues better and take a more active part in the work. This appears
to have worked so far, with increased participation on the monthly call.

In response to Oksana's suggestion that ALS *representatives* should be
able to be an ALS *representative* in another region, this is forbidden
in the ALAC bylaws for a reason to make sure there might not be a
possibility of manipulation/capture. It is 99.9% sure that this cannot
change because any change to this rule would need approval from the ALAC
and approval from the Board and I don't see this happening ever.

Of course, there is no rule against being a simple member of several
ALSes. I am a member of 3 ALSes in 3 different regions; some are members
of more than 3, in different or in the same region, it doesn't matter.
